My hubby and I have a business which includes t-shirts. We've been doing this for about 3 years now, and are moving up past the dreaded Speedball materials.

We're almost finished with our 4-color press (http://www.printingplans.com) and we're going to start doing more complicated designs than the simple 1-color we've been doing. I think we've decided to try Matsui water-based inks, as we're in Denver, and we've been told that Matsui dries less fast than Permaset (we don't like plastisol, either how it looks, or feels). What I'm wondering about is brands of screens to recommend, any other photo emulsion than Diazo, and a good place to buy supplies. We've been buying them from a local Guiry's and art supply store, but all they have are the dreaded Speedball products.

Also, what type of dryer/curing machine to use? And, where we can get one for cheap. We've just been ironing the shirts, as it's simple, and free, but extremely time consuming.

We don't have to worry about really technical aspects of screen printing, because none of our designs are that terribly intricate or complicated; most of it is basic text things (http://www.etsy.com/shop/naniwear?section_id=7102084 for examples of what we do). This is why I think we'd be fine with just water-based inks.
